About this route:
A direct, nonstop flight between Oconee County Regional Airport (CEU), Clemson, South Carolina, United States and Hakodate Airport (HKD), Hakodate, Hokkaidō, Japan would travel a Great Circle distance of 6,474 miles (or 10,418 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Oconee County Regional Airport and Hakodate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Hakodate Airport (HKD):
- The closest airport to Hakodate Airport (HKD) is Aomori Airport (AOJ), which is located 72 miles (116 kilometers) S of HKD.
- Hakodate Airport (HKD) currently has only 1 runway.
- The furthest airport from Hakodate Airport (HKD) is Rio Grande Regional Airport (RIG), which is located 11,458 miles (18,440 kilometers) away in Rio Grande, Brazil.
- In addition to being known as "Hakodate Airport", other names for HKD include "函館空港" and "Hakodate Kūkō".
- On September 6, 1976, Soviet pilot Viktor Belenko defected to the West by landing a MiG-25 Foxbat aircraft at Hakodate Airport.
- Because of Hakodate Airport's relatively low elevation of 112 feet, planes can take off or land at Hakodate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
